SynbioTech to Showcase Innovative Microbiome Solutions for Women's Healthy Aging at Vitafoods Europe 2026

SynbioTech at Vitafoods Europe 2026: Revolutionizing Women's Healthy Aging



SynbioTech, a leading innovator in probiotic and postbiotic solutions based in Taiwan, is gearing up to unveil its portfolio designed to support women's healthy aging at the prestigious Vitafoods Europe event. Scheduled from May 5 to 7 at the Fira Barcelona Gran Via in Spain, this showcase promises to highlight the latest advancements in microbiome-based ingredients tailored for women's health.

A Shift Towards Holistic Health



The landscape of women's wellness is experiencing a dramatic transformation. The focus is shifting from narrow health claims to a broader standard of holistic vitality that emphasizes long-term strength, functionality, and overall quality of life. According to Future Market Insights, the global healthy aging supplement market, which was valued at USD 1.41 billion in 2024, is projected to reach USD 2.16 billion by 2034. Similarly, Grand View Research indicates that the global market for women's health reached USD 38.30 billion in 2024 and is anticipated to reach USD 51.76 billion by 2030.

Such trends create significant opportunities for brands involved in women’s health, as they explore ways to address the complex needs of aging consumers.

The Role of Microbiome Science



As women's health perspectives expand, the demand for product concepts that reflect the interconnectedness of well-being increases. Traditional categories such as muscle maintenance, digestion, and mobility are now recognized as integral parts of the same objective: helping women remain active and independent longer.

Microbiome science, particularly through probiotics and postbiotics, is gaining traction for its potential benefits that go beyond mere digestive health. It plays a pivotal role in supporting gut health, muscle function, and metabolic wellness, addressing multifaceted aspects of women's aging.

Highlighting TWK10®: From Sports to Active Aging



A cornerstone of SynbioTech’s presentation will be TWK10®, a proprietary strain of Lactiplantibacillus plantarum noted for its applications in sports and active nutrition. This strain is rapidly gaining importance in the realm of active aging, where preserving muscle mass, strength, and mobility are essential for older adults. With backing from numerous clinical studies, TWK10® has demonstrated tangible benefits, including:
  • - 3% increase in muscle mass
  • - 13% improvement in grip strength
  • - 16.8% improvement in mobility and agility
  • - 51% boost in endurance and stamina

Additionally, TWK10® enhances total amino acid absorption, promoting better protein utilization via the gut–muscle axis, making it an ideal candidate for formulations aimed at women seeking vitality and long-term physical wellness.

Diverse Probiotic Solutions for Women



At the Vitafoods Europe event, SynbioTech will spotlight a wider range of probiotic and postbiotic solutions addressing the intricate health considerations of aging women. Key products include:
  • - ABKefir®: A symbiotic blend of seven strains that has shown efficacy in reducing gastrointestinal discomfort such as constipation and bloating.
  • - SynForU® HerCare: A six-strain probiotic that has demonstrated positive effects on recurrent vaginal infections, improving women’s health by promoting a balanced vaginal microbiota.
  • - LDL557™: This postbiotic targets joint integrity with promising outcomes in reducing cartilage loss and joint damage, suggesting a new approach to joint health beyond conventional methods.
  • - SynForU® ReMain: Focused on renal wellness, this product has shown promising results in improving kidney health metrics and reducing harmful uremic toxin markers.
  • - FS4722™: Known for its potential to regulate uric acid levels, this strain reinforces metabolic health through the gut–liver–kidney pathway.

Each of these solutions showcases an evolving understanding of women’s health, stressing the importance of a comprehensive approach that intertwines mobility, gut health, metabolic balance, and personal wellness as women age.
